Chlorine is a strong oxidizing agent and it may inhibit the microbial progress during wastewater BOD analysis, so it ought to be removed from sample right before start off the analysis. Chlorine could be eradicated by incorporating the sodium sulfite into the sample in adhering to fashion.

The level of oxidation throughout a 5-d incubation of nitrogenous compounds will depend on the concentration and type of microorganisms that may carry out this oxidation. Organisms capable of oxidizing nitrogenous compounds fairly often are present in raw or settled Main sewage in ample numbers to oxidize adequate lowered nitrogen sorts to lead oxygen demand while in the five-d BOD test.

It's not at all proposed to utilize deionized water from an ion Trade column. Encounter has revealed that deionized water, notably from the new demineralizer with new resin, frequently includes significant amounts of natural make a difference, that is produced intermittently and is undetectable with a conductivity water purity gauge.

In fish dying from this condition, exterior bubbles (emphysema) could possibly be viewed on fins, skin, round the eyes or on other tissues. Aquatic invertebrates also are influenced by gasoline bubble disorder, but at degrees bigger than Those people lethal to fish.
